Court To Review Damages In Microsoft Patent Case

WASHINGTON (CN) - The Federal Circuit told a lower court to reconsider the amount of damages Microsoft must pay to inventor Carlos Armando Amado for infringing his patented software in several versions of Office Suite. The district court failed to explain how it calculated the damage award of 12 cents per copy, the circuit ruled.
